IDSA needs your help to educate members of Congress about the value of ID specialists and why a proposal to eliminate consultation codes used by many ID physicians is a bad idea (see IDSA News article). Many IDSA members have sent comment letters to the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S) about this proposal, but grassroots advocacy is still needed. Medicare’s final rule will be published in November. In the meantime, you can raise awareness among your senators and representatives about this important issue, how it affects ID physicians, and the consequences for patient care. See IDSA’s website for more information about how you can make a difference today.
To learn more about the proposal and IDSA’s position, see this position statement recently published in Clinical Infectious Diseases. IDSA also is working in collaboration with several other specialty societies to urge the American Medical Association to take a stronger position against Medicare’s consultations proposal.
